Cork boy, 11, given dream day out watching his beloved Everton

A young Irish Everton fan whose emotional response to learning he would be making his dream first trip to watch the Blues play was widely shared on social media had a Goodison debut he will never forget - including bagging a pair of Seamus Coleman's boots.

Ruairc, who will turn 11 on Wednesday, broke into tears of joy as he was filmed by his parents opening a letter explaining he would be travelling from his home in Cork, Ireland to attend the Toffees’ Premier League clash with Bournemouth.
